Plamo Radicon

Heres the final bunch of photos from the Plamo Radicon show.
The Keroro Gunsou medium sized toys with the changing eyes would speak phrases such as the time when you spoke to them. Cool but could be noisy.
The Yamato ship was impressive with moving cannons n lights - would look cool hanging from the ceiling with the lights dimmed down low.
The GFF Keroro figures looked really small and didnt really have an impact for some reason.
You can see a guy spraying a car next to some contraption which vacuums in the paint and spits it out of the window or into a bucket of water. Not sure how useful this is though.
The small three cars with white remotes where cool - great to play about in board meetings.
First time I saw the Macross fortress - wanted to take it home with me.
